#035126 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#035126 is composed of 1.2% red, 31.8%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.1%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 146.9 degrees, a saturation of 92.9% and a lightness of 16.5%. #035126 color hex could be obtained by blending #06a24c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#035126

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000503 is the darkest color, while #f1fef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#035126

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2a2a2a is the less saturated color, while #035126 is the most saturated one.
